Abstract

This document relates to a fuel oil composition comprising: (i) a solid hydrocarbonaceous and/or solid carbonaceous material, wherein the material is in particulate form, and wherein at least about 90% by volume (% v) of the particles are no greater than about 20 microns in diameter; and (ii) a liquid fuel oil; wherein the solid hydrocarbonaceous and/or solid carbonaceous material is present in an amount of at most about 30 by mass (% m) based on the total mass of the fuel oil composition. The invention further relates a process for the preparation of this fuel oil composition, a method of changing a grade of a liquid fuel oil, and a method for adjusting the flash point of a liquid fuel oil.

Claims (29)

1. A fuel oil composition comprising:

(i) a particulate material, wherein at least about 90% by volume (% v) of the particles are no greater than about 20 microns in diameter; and

(ii) a liquid fuel oil;

wherein the particulate material is present in an amount of at most about 30 by mass (% m) based on the total mass of the fuel oil composition;

wherein the particulate material comprises coal, wherein the coal comprises sedimentary mineral-derived solid carbonaceous material selected from hard coal, anthracite, bituminous coal, sub-bituminous coal, brown coal, lignite, or combinations thereof; and

wherein the particulate material comprises less than 5% m of ash content.

2. A fuel oil composition of claim 1 , wherein the particulate material comprises microfine coal.

3. A fuel oil composition of claim 2 , wherein at least 95% v of the particles are no greater than about 20 microns in diameter.

4. A fuel oil composition of claim 1 , wherein the particulate material is dewatered prior to combination with the liquid fuel oil.

5. A fuel oil composition of claim 1 , wherein the particulate material is subjected to a de-ashing step or a de-mineralizing step prior to combination with the liquid fuel oil.

6. A fuel oil composition of claim 2 , wherein the microfine coal comprises an ash content of less than about 1% m.

7. A fuel oil composition of claim 1 , wherein the liquid fuel oil is selected from one of the group consisting of: marine diesel; diesel for stationary applications; kerosene for stationary applications; marine bunker oil; residual fuel oil; and heavy fuel oil.
